JTAN is a long-established traditional internet service provider. According to its website, it has been operating since 1991. Rather than positioning itself as a modern VPS or cloud server provider, JTAN focuses on Unix Shell access, web hosting, email, DNS, PHP/MySQL, dynamic DNS, proxy, and tunneling services. Its main appeal is that it still offers full shell access along with a relatively strong set of privacy tools, including Web Proxy, Tor-related proxy options, and tunneling capabilities. It is best suited to old-school technical users who understand Unix and need a lightweight environment for websites, email, and privacy-oriented access.
Its drawbacks are also clear: there are no explicit VPS specifications, data center locations, bandwidth port details, China-optimized routes, DDoS protection, or refund policy. The only clearly mentioned payment method is BTC, and the service is not particularly friendly to Chinese-speaking users. Overall, JTAN is more of a privacy-oriented traditional shell/web hosting service than an overseas VPS option for Chinese webmasters or cross-border businesses.
